自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 收藏
  • 关注

原创 ubuntu 离线安装makefile

ubuntu 离线安装makefileubuntu 离线安装makefile到http://ftp.gnu.org/gnu/make/ 下载make 安装包 我下的是make-3.81.tar.gz复制到机器上,解压并进入目录tar -xzvf make-3.81.tar.gzcd make-3.81依次执行以下命令./configure./make check./make inst

2017-04-29 21:03:16 7566 4

原创 python os.system() 空格处理

背景:今天写了一个小脚本来自动执行exe文件原脚本:for _ in range(15): os.system('Time-varying workflow.exe') time.sleep(1)报错:并没有找到文件原因:os.system()还是用空格把字符串给拆成了不同的部分,然后再调用shell来执行。解决办法:使用subprocess模块加双引号for _ in r

2017-03-15 14:41:24 2850

转载 apt-get 错误“无法获得锁 /var/lib/dpkg/lock...” 解决办法

在用sudo apt-get install 安装软件时,由于速度太慢,想换个软件源,直接关闭了终端,但apt-get进程没有结束,结果终端提示E: 无法获得锁 /var/lib/dpkg/lock - open (11: 资源暂时不可用)E: 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?”解决办法如下:终端输入 ps -aux ,列出进程。找到含有apt-get

2017-02-27 22:09:14 587

原创 数据结构:有向无环图的表示

数据结构:有向无环图的表示最近在做workflow的时候有用到怎么去存储一个有向无环图,在百度上看到一个答复感觉很棒 http://blog.chinaunix.net/uid-24774106-id-3505579.html文中使用先是 malloc 一个内存然后每当超出长度的时候就 realloc 内存(其实感觉跟 python 的 list 差不多)后面发现其实可以用vector,不用实现那

2017-02-10 11:22:31 6587

原创 MPI 学习笔记

message passing modelthe Message Passing Interface (MPI) - standard interfaceMPI is only a definition for an interface几个重要的概念communicator: 由一系列进程组成,拥有沟通的能力每个进程都有 rank 沟通交流靠秩 + tag(标记信息)point-to-p

2017-01-11 09:54:20 10246

原创 ubuntu12.04 源码安装 mpich2

ubuntu12.04 源码安装 mpich2从 mpich 官网 上下载 mpich2 的源码包解压并进入>>> tar -xzf mpich2-1.4.tar.gz>>> cd mpich2-1.4configure./configure --disable-fortran安装make; sudo make install我执行完以上步骤的时候编译通过,但是执行报错,关于动态链

2017-01-07 17:00:08 1028

原创 Piotr's matlab toolbox 出现的问题及解决方法

Piotr’s matlab toolbox 遇到的问题背景:最近想使用计算机视觉大牛 piotor 的工具箱中的acfdetector。下载:git clone https://github.com/pdollar/toolbox.git在 matlab 中添加路径>>> addpath(genpath('~\toolbox\')) %这里是你的路径>>> savepath编译>

2016-12-27 10:59:53 1530

原创 ubuntu server 16.04 挂载多个硬盘并设置自启挂载

实验室最近新购了一批主机,带4个硬盘,但是进去只有1个正在使用。 检查发现系统上目前并没有挂载其余硬盘fdisk -l尝试过直接挂载单数出现错误如下:wrong fs type, bad option, bad superblock个人猜测是没有格式化,硬盘格式不对。 执行以下命令格式化 sdx:sudo mkfs -t ext4 /dev/sdb说明: * -t ext4 表示将分区格式化成

2016-12-03 11:38:08 3098

原创 阿里云ubuntu16.04上搭建gunicorn+supervisor+nginx详解

ubuntu上搭建gunicorn+supervisor+nginx① pip安装gunicornpip install gunicorn关于gunicorn的启动命令是:gunicorn -w 4 -b 0.0.0.0:7000 myapp: app② pip 安装supervisorsudo pip install supervisor注意:需要在安装在sudo下 配置方式:echo_ sup

2016-11-25 11:11:48 641

原创 Ubuntu 16.04换apt源

Ubuntu 16.04换apt源cd etc/aptcp source.list source.list.baksudo vim source.list更改文件如下:deb http://mirrors.aliyun.com/ubuntu/ xenial main restricted universe multiversedeb http://mirrors.aliyun.com/ubun

2016-11-25 11:06:54 844

原创 ubuntu server 16.04 配置网络

ubuntu server 16.04 配置网络DELL PowerEdgeT630 装好系统后按传统方法配网络失败,折腾一番才知道是网卡名字不对路查看网卡具体信息(我的网卡名字是eno1,通常是eth0)ifconfig -a下面这个命令没啥用 看网卡信息的lspci -v | grep eth先看网卡有没有开ifconfig没有开的话就开网络ifconfig eno1 upsud

2016-11-25 11:04:11 2648 2

原创 windows下pytesseract识别验证码遇到的WindowsError: [Error 2] 的解决方法

安装PIL+pytesseract安装很简单,参考http://www.waitalone.cn/python-php-ocr.html从http://www.lfd.uci.edu/~gohlke/pythonlibs/里面下载pillow选择自己的版本即可, 我是2.7,然而这里有个问题,明明我机子是64位的,我下载了64位的whl然后pip安装的时候居然报错了,说格式不支持,然后我就

2016-08-29 10:25:30 9576 4

转载 C++中虚函数的继承

一:继承中的指针问题。1. 指向基类的指针可以指向派生类对象,当基类指针指向派生类对象时,这种指针只能访问派生对象从基类继承而来的那些成员,不能访问子类特有的元素 ,除非应用强类型转换,例如有基类B和从B派生的子类D,则B *p;D dd; p=ⅆ是可以的,指针p只能访问从基类派生而来的成员,不能访问派生类D特有的成员.因为基类不知道派生类中的这些成员。 2. 不能使派生类指针指向基类对象 .

2016-08-04 22:20:38 866

原创 python执行json.loads(...)时遇到的错误

最近在编写web程序需要用到redis来存储json格式,因为redis的存储室二进制,所以在提取数据的时候需要用到将二进制解码为utf-8,然后再转化为json。    前面解码没问题用decode(‘utf-8’)就可以了,原来的代码是这样子的: messages.append(json.loads(mess.decode('utf-8')))    好像没啥问题,但结果却报错了!

2016-07-07 22:41:17 42598 1

转载 redis-py API Reference

Redis 是一个高性能的key-value数据库。 它支持存储的value类型包括string、hash、list、set 和 zset等。redis还支持各种不同方式的排序。All the commands available in Redis 2.0.0. API Referenceappend(self, key, value)Appends the str

2016-07-07 18:24:59 347

转载 redis简单使用方法

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。Red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ash(哈希类型)。这些数据类型都支

2016-07-07 15:32:33 1857

转载 SQLAlchemy技术文档(中文版)(上)

原文链接:http://www.cnblogs.com/iwangzc/p/4112078.html(感谢作者的分享)1.版本检查import sqlalchemysqlalchemy.__version__2.连接from sqlalchemy import create_engineengine = create_engine('sqlite:///:memory:

2016-06-05 16:26:53 368

转载 PYthon读串口

Python中用于读串口的模块是 pySerial,使用非常的方便,可以从http://pypi.python.org/pypi/pyserial下载其安装包。读取串口时首先导入包 import serial,其次设置读取哪一个口、波特率、数据位、停止位。serial的原型如下:[python] view plain copyclas

2016-05-27 10:25:57 1235

原创 Python源码剖析-Dict

为了刻画某种关系,现代的编程语言都会提供关联式的容器。关联式容器中的元素分别是以(键(key)或值(value))这样的形式存在。例如(3,5)(3,6)就是一对对应的键与值。Python中的关联式容器是PyDictObject。Python通过PyDictObject建立执行Python字节码的运行环境,其中会存放变量名和变量值的元素对,通过查找变量名获得变量值。PyDictObject

2016-05-24 21:05:28 1778

原创 flask发送邮件问题(yeah.net与Gmail设置的不同)

在利用flask发送注册确认邮件时,在《flask web实战》里面是用Gmail,因为是在国内如果用Gmail不稳定,故选用国内的邮件,选择国内的邮件发送发现一直不能够发送成功。最后在排除原因时发现是协议的问题,教程里面TLS协议定义为True,我把TSL协议改为False,再应用ssl协议就可以发送成功。配置 Flask-Mail 使用 Gmailimport os

2016-05-12 23:19:10 10782

原创 python源码解析笔记--List

此文为读《python源码解剖》第四章LIST对象的笔记List在python源码里面是PyLstObject新创建的PyLstObject的对象如下(长度为6)向list设置值(set)步骤(1)类型检查(2)索引检查(看是否小于0或大于list的长度)(3)对目的地址赋值 (4)对旧元素的引用减一 (因为旧元素的类型很有可能是NoneObject,所以这里要用Py_XD

2016-05-11 21:33:53 675

转载 阿里云部署 Flask + WSGI + Nginx 详解

感谢原文作者http://www.cnblogs.com/Ray-liang/p/4173923.html?utm_source=tuicool&utm_medium=referral我采用的部署方案是:Web 服务器采用 uwsgi host Flask用 Supervisor 引用 uwsgi 作常规启动服务基于 Nginx 作反向代理首先, 阿

2016-05-11 15:21:55 6397 1

转载 char 与 unsigned char

在tcp协议中,定义一个字节都是用unsigned char,一直不懂为什么?直到看到这篇文章,才知道关键是unsigned char不会自动扩展。 原文地址:http://www.cnblogs.com/qytan36/archive/2010/09/27/1836569.html在C中,默认的基础数据类型均为signed,现在我们以char为例,说明(signed) char与un

2016-05-08 16:56:29 342

原创 十六进制颜色及其对应的名称

最近在用flask做网页是会碰到HTML设置颜色问题,故在此mark一下颜色名称和其十六进制表达式,以便不时之需。ps:因为我用的是深色背景,所以最后我最后用了庚斯博罗灰色:gainsboro代码中直接在标签中style="color=gainsboro"即可英文代码  形像颜色  HEX格式  RGB格式  LightPink

2016-05-07 13:23:41 4357

转载 MySQL 入门教程

21分钟 MySQL 入门教程转自 http://www.cnblogs.com/mr-wid/archive/2013/05/09/3068229.html#c3,感谢作者wid目录一、MySQL的相关概念介绍二、Windows下MySQL的配置配置步骤MySQL服务的启动、停止与卸载三、MySQL脚本的基本组成四、MySQL中的数据类型五、使用MySQL

2016-04-30 15:24:17 300

原创 python的异常处理机制

本菜鸟在用flask后台开发的时候经常会遇到异常管理机制的问题,例如登陆密码不匹配,没有输入等等。借此来学习一下python的异常管理机制。1、try...excepttry...except...finally这是我用得比较多的语句,python先执行try下的语句如果遇到错误就执行except下的语句,最后假如有finally语句的话,无论正确与否都得执行。说明:每个try

2016-04-29 20:36:38 2565

原创 python的内置方法

最近需要重新定义类,老是会忘记python内置方法的的作用和名称,mark一下加深一下记忆。基本上python的常见内置方法如下面所示: 内置方法                      说明 __init__(self,...)          初始化对象,在创建新对象时调用 __del__(self)               释放对象,在对象被删除之前调用 

2016-04-29 17:55:05 427

原创 利用js和html实现表单操作(onsubmit、onclick、submit等方法的异同)

最近在写利用python+flask搭建后台,在写到与前端交互的时候需要对form进行数据过滤,但是在写onsubmit方法的时候老是达不到自己想要的效果,所以百度了一下这几种方法异同,顺带研究了下onclick、onsubmit、submit集合函数之间的关系和区别。下面的介绍是在http://blog.csdn.net/wguoyong/article/details/7461511看

2016-04-28 21:24:12 3257

原创 初探python

接触python不知不觉已经有两个月了,在这过程中用过了pyqt、flask等,感觉python是一个很强大的胶水语言,虽然现在还没体验到其“胶水”特性,目前正在学习,希望有所收获Is python a"Scripting Languague"?Python是脚本语言吗?人们见到pyhon第一印象就是脚本语言四个字,那到底是不是呢?其实我觉得这就像有人问你“你是男人还是人?”我会更觉得py

2016-04-27 22:48:38 273

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除